Re: hyperlinks
What you do is click the URL link tab, which produces the following code:
Next you type in the actualy url like so:
{url=http://blahblahblah.com]Provers 1:234[/url]
tadaa!
P.S. I used a { instead of a [ in front just to illustrate. Otherwise you'd see the actual hyperlink instead of the example
